# Which bids should receive scarce proposal capacity?

> Build a dated portfolio allocation that protects client work, funds viable bid gates and releases capacity from pursuits that should wait or stop.

By [Tony Kim](https://zephior.com/authors/tony-kim). Published 2026-09-03; updated 2026-09-03. 19 minute read.

## Definition

Bid portfolio capacity allocation decides which live pursuits receive which constrained people, approval slots and production capacity during a fixed planning horizon. Its work product is a `bid_portfolio_capacity_allocation_record`. The record contains the portfolio snapshot, protected delivery commitments, usable supply by skill and period, imported bid-demand ranges, mandatory gates, timing and dependency constraints, comparable portfolio scenarios, authorized allocations, wait or release decisions, evidence dates and expiry triggers. It is distinct from estimating one response, resolving one deadline collision or assessing the economics of one bid. It never treats nominal headcount as available capacity and never authorizes overtime, reassignment, external spend or submission by itself.

## Problem

A pipeline can look healthy while the delivery system is already overdrawn. Every opportunity owner books the same architect, commercial approver and proposal lead against a different local plan. Customer work appears as a background percentage rather than a dated obligation. Early-stage pursuits consume workshops and research because nobody has set a capacity gate, while a later, stronger bid waits for review. Teams then solve the visible clash with overtime or thin slices of attention. The result is a portfolio in which every bid is active, few are properly resourced and signed client commitments carry the hidden risk. A weighted score does not repair this. Scores cannot create a security reviewer on Tuesday, divide an indivisible pricing authority or show which pursuit must release work for another to become feasible.

## Point of view

Protect contracted delivery, operational duties, leave and an approved reserve before distributing bid capacity. Model supply by skill, authority, place and time; model demand by the next decision gate rather than by the full imagined response. Import eligibility, effort, delivery fit, contract risk, contribution and award evidence from their accountable records. Eliminate paths that fail a hard gate, then compare feasible portfolio scenarios under the same horizon and uncertainty treatment. A human authority chooses the allocation and records what must pause or stop so capacity is released in practice. An agent may reconcile calendars, detect double booking, solve bounded scenarios and explain the trade-off. It cannot rank people by inferred productivity, disclose private personnel data, move staff, approve spend or kill a bid. ## Freeze a portfolio snapshot before comparing demand

A portfolio allocation needs a cut-off. Record every live pursuit and material pre-bid activity known at that time, including proposals not yet authorized to proceed. For each item, retain the buyer, procedure, lot, stage, controlling document version, next gate, official deadline, internal safe date and accountable owner. The snapshot should also show work that is absent because it falls outside the chosen business unit, geography or horizon. Without those boundaries, an opportunity can enter after the decision and consume capacity without displacing anything on paper.

Choose a horizon that matches the evidence. A twelve-month revenue plan is too coarse for daily specialist assignments, while a one-week board conceals the next wave of bids. Many teams need two linked views: a rolling six- to twelve-week allocation for named work and a longer directional view for hiring or contracted support. The near view grants capacity. The long view signals likely shortages but does not book a person against an unqualified opportunity.

Use one source cut and one decision authority. Opportunity owners submit their current records before the cut-off. Changes after it enter a visible log with the source, time and affected constraint. This protects the comparison from private optimism and creates a reasoned path to reopen the decision. It also lets an agent distinguish an obsolete allocation from the one currently in force.

## Protect delivery before declaring any bid capacity

Start from gross working time only to reconcile the calendar. Deduct signed customer delivery, incident and service coverage, regulatory work, management duties, approved leave, training and any protected improvement work. Then apply the organization’s approved reserve for disruption and forecast error. The remainder is not automatically fungible. A proposal writer, security architect and delegated pricing approver represent different capacity pools even when each has an unbooked day.

GovS 002 version 2.1 describes resource management as balancing supply and demand for the right skills, equipment and facilities when needed. It also requires business, operational and service continuity when critical resources are lost. Applied here, a portfolio plan that succeeds only by stripping cover from contracted work is infeasible. The delivery owner must confirm what is protected and the portfolio authority must record any authorized exception rather than burying it in a percentage.

Classify supply as `confirmed`, `conditional`, `provisional`, `unverified` or `unavailable`. A contractor option is conditional until commercial authority, start date, access and relevant competence are proved. A colleague expected to finish another project is provisional until its owner releases the time. Include access, language, geography, conflict and delegated authority. Preserve only the personal detail required for the decision; an agent normally needs a pseudonymous resource ID and verified capabilities, not performance notes or health information.

## Fund the next decision gate rather than the imagined full bid

Each pursuit requests a small set of dated work packages. A work package names its output, required skill or authority, earliest start, need date, effort range, dependencies and completion evidence. The portfolio imports the estimate rather than asking opportunity owners for a rounded staffing wish. Demand for a new solution design remains separate from response writing. One hour of authorized contract review cannot be exchanged for one hour of formatting simply because both are labeled bid effort.

Plan only to the next reversible gate unless later work must be reserved now. An early opportunity might need qualification research and one solution-fit decision, not a submission team. A live tender might need the minimum compliant response through solution freeze, after which the portfolio can reassess. This staged treatment keeps uncertain future work from crowding out approved delivery and current bids. It also prevents a proceed decision from becoming an open-ended claim on the team.

Import rather than recreate the evidence that changes allocation. Eligibility comes from its qualification record. Response effort comes from a work estimate. Delivery fit, contract exposure, contribution, award probability and remaining bid investment retain their owners, dates and ranges. Missing evidence stays missing. A capacity board should not raise a probability or suppress a risk because the preferred portfolio otherwise fails.

## Find the constraint that changes the feasible portfolio

An overload report is only the start. Test whether moving work within its allowable window removes the shortage. Then test permitted delegation, preparation by another role, reuse of approved evidence and reduction to the minimum safe response. Preserve dependencies and approval rights while doing so. If the solution architect remains over capacity in week three after all safe moves, that pool is binding. Extra writing capacity will not change the feasible set.

Some work is divisible and some is not. Research can be split by notice. A coherent solution baseline, pricing decision, executive review or final release often needs one owner and a protected block. Ten spare half-hours do not necessarily replace one five-hour reasoning block. Include setup, handoff and context loss where they materially consume the scarce pool. Do not assign a universal productivity penalty. Use the observed work pattern or an explicit assumption with a range.

Show slack as carefully as shortage. If writers have capacity but legal approval is binding, buying more drafting hides the problem. If the portfolio fits after one low-confidence demand estimate is corrected, the correct action may be to improve that estimate. The record should name the binding pool, the time bucket, the amount and range of shortfall, the bids affected and the smallest decision that changes feasibility.

## Compare feasible combinations, not isolated bid scores

A bid can rank first on its own and still produce a weaker portfolio. It may consume the only specialist needed by two smaller pursuits whose combined contribution, learning or strategic coverage is stronger. The reverse can also be true: splitting across the two can leave both below their credible response floor. Construct complete scenarios that state which gates are funded, which work remains protected and which bids wait or release capacity. Infeasible scenarios stay visible with the violated constraint.

Use current evidence on eligibility, contribution, award probability, strategic outcome, contractual exposure and timing, but keep unlike measures separate. The 2026 Green Book supports comparing options, opportunity cost, uncertainty, sensitivity and switching values. It is public-sector appraisal guidance, not a bidder ranking formula. The transferable discipline is to expose alternatives and the assumption that changes the preference. Do not turn every consideration into points and call the resulting total objective.

Run at least a current case and the credible adverse corner that matters: lower supply, higher effort, a delayed approval or a delivery incident. Matched scenarios prevent a portfolio from using high contribution, low effort and high capacity assumptions that cannot coexist. The authorized decision can prefer resilience over the highest central estimate. Record the reason, contrary evidence and the switching event that would justify another mix.

## An allocation works only when lower-priority bookings are released

Issue a decision for every included pursuit. `fund_to_next_gate` grants named capacity through a bounded output. `maintain_minimum_safe_capacity` preserves a credible floor but defers enhancements. `conditional_reserve` holds a limited slot until specified proof arrives. `waitlist` grants no current booking and names the release condition. `pause_and_release` and `stop_and_release` require owners to cancel meetings, tasks, contractor requests and provisional holds. `indeterminate` records the missing fact. `authority_missing` blocks implementation.

Each granted block needs a pool, amount, period, work package, accountable bid owner and capacity owner. State whether unused capacity returns automatically and whether one pursuit may borrow from another. A waitlist must not become shadow work carried through favors. A pause should specify what record remains current and what must be revalidated before restart. If a stop is required because facts changed after work began, use the dedicated live-bid stop process rather than hiding closure inside the capacity plan.

GovS 002 treats portfolio management as recurring work and calls for current component records, defined planning horizons, allocation rules and approved changes. The Orange Book adds risk appetite, clear responsibility, current reporting and escalation triggers. Those principles support a short-lived allocation record. It expires when the horizon ends, a bid passes its funded gate or a named material event occurs. The old record remains available for explanation and calibration, but it no longer grants capacity.

## Give agents a decision record they can verify without exposing people

Consider an illustrative six-week portfolio with four live bids. After protected client work, the team has twenty-four proposal days, five security-review days and three delegated pricing slots. Bid A needs eight proposal days and two security days to reach solution freeze in week two. Bid B needs ten proposal days and two pricing slots by week five. Bid C requests six proposal days, but its mandatory certification remains unresolved. Bid D needs nine proposal days and three security days for a later submission. These numbers are an example, not a productivity benchmark.

The record does not rank all four and fill from the top. It withholds C from the feasible set until the certification gate is resolved. It tests A plus B, A plus D and B plus D against time buckets and minimum plans. If A plus D exceeds security supply in week two even though the six-week total fits, the scenario is infeasible unless an approved timing or staffing change removes that specific conflict. The human authority may fund A and B, place D on a dated waitlist and assign C an eligibility action with no response booking.

An agent receives pseudonymous capacity pools, source references, ranges, constraints, decisions, contrary evidence and expiry. It can answer why D is waiting, what additional security capacity would change and which source made C conditional. It should not receive private salary, health or performance data. ## Workflow

1. **Freeze the portfolio cut.** Set the decision time, planning horizon, included pursuits, current stages, source versions and allocation authority. Record late or incomplete inputs rather than allowing opportunity owners to update the comparison privately.
2. **Protect non-bid commitments.** Reserve signed delivery, service operations, regulatory duties, leave, training and an approved disruption allowance. Obtain confirmation from the owners of those commitments before calling the residual supply available.
3. **Build capacity pools.** Express usable supply by skill, decision authority, location, access condition and time bucket. Keep confirmed, conditional, provisional and unavailable capacity separate, and include the cost of handoff and context switching.
4. **Import demand to the next gate.** Bring in each bid’s current effort range, critical deadlines, mandatory outputs, dependencies and minimum safe response. Request only the capacity needed to reach the next reversible decision point.
5. **Run gates and scenarios.** Remove options that fail eligibility, authority or another non-curable gate. Test several feasible allocations against skill-time constraints, protected work, value evidence, risk appetite and uncertainty instead of relying on a single ranking.
6. **Authorize allocation and release.** Assign capacity to named outputs and gates. State which pursuits receive minimum cover, conditional reserve, a wait position, a pause or a stop, and issue the actions needed to release bookings that no longer belong in the plan.
7. **Monitor the constraint.** Compare actual use with the allocation, watch the named bottleneck and reopen the record when deadlines, scope, evidence, supply or protected work crosses a trigger. Expire approval at the end of the horizon or gate.

## Risks

- Nominal full-time equivalents may be presented as supply while signed delivery and operating work is omitted.
- Each pursuit may reserve the same specialist because local plans are never reconciled.
- A single weighted score may hide a failed gate, indivisible approval or impossible sequence.
- Framework ceilings, options or total contract value may be compared as though they were expected contribution.
- A weak early-stage pursuit may consume capacity before a stronger later bid reaches the planning horizon.
- Conditional partner or contractor availability may be treated as confirmed without authority or dates.
- Evenly splitting scarce experts may leave several bids below their minimum credible response.
- Frequent reprioritization may consume the capacity that the process is trying to allocate.
- A pause may remain staffed because assignments, meetings and access are not explicitly released.
- Overtime may be smuggled into the feasible case without approval, cost or quality limits.
- Personal performance, health, customer or commercially sensitive data may be exposed beyond need.
- External support may be purchased even though the true blocker is eligibility, authority, evidence or product fit.

## Frequently asked questions

### Should the highest-value bid always receive capacity first?

No. Compare complete feasible portfolio scenarios using consistent contribution, probability, risk, timing and capacity evidence. A high-value bid can fail a hard gate or consume an indivisible constraint needed by a stronger combination.

### How far ahead should bid capacity be planned?

Use a near horizon supported by current calendars and bid evidence, often several weeks, plus a separate directional view for hiring or external support. Only the near plan should grant named capacity.

### Should client delivery capacity ever be moved to a bid?

Only an authorized owner can approve a documented exception after seeing the delivery consequence, alternatives and risk. The default allocation protects signed and operational commitments before bid work.

### Can one score decide the bid portfolio?

A score can organize evidence but cannot prove feasibility or replace authority. Keep hard gates, skill-time constraints, uncertainty, risk and unlike value dimensions visible.

### What is the difference from prioritizing colliding deadlines?

Deadline-collision work resolves a defined urgent clash among already-live responses. Portfolio allocation repeatedly governs current and upcoming pursuit demand, protected delivery, reserves and gate funding across a wider horizon.

### What does a waitlist mean for a bid?

It means the pursuit has no present booking. The record names the condition, latest useful release date and authority for granting capacity. Informal shadow work is not permitted.

### Can an agent allocate people automatically?

It may reconcile inputs, detect conflicts and propose bounded scenarios. A delegated human approves the allocation, and separate authority is required for reassignment, overtime, external spend or bid closure.
